Studio City plumbing splits by the Ventura Boulevard divide. South of Ventura (the flats), 1950s–1970s ranch-style single-family homes on slab dominate. They share the typical SFV pattern: slab-leak risk on aging copper, hard-water sediment in tank water heaters, and root intrusion from mature street trees. North of Ventura into the hills (Fryman Canyon, Tujunga Wash, Coldwater Canyon), terrain drives a different set of issues: pressure regulator failures from elevation-induced overnight pressure spikes, sewer-line offset issues from slope, harder-to-access supply line repairs. The post-2005 high-end rebuilds in Studio City Hills typically have PEX repipes and tankless water heaters but bring tankless heat exchanger scaling concerns. LADWP water at 14–17 grains per gallon — typical SFV hardness.
Gas line work in Studio City reflects the SFV norm — original 1/2-inch runs needing upgrades for modern appliances. Hillside Studio City homes often need creative routing through crawlspace, garage soffit, or exterior elevation transitions. City of LA permits required for new lines.
Recent Studio City gas line: a 1968 hillside home wanted a tankless conversion plus a new gas dryer hookup. Ran 28 feet of new 3/4-inch black-iron through accessible crawlspace and garage soffit. Pulled permit, pressure-tested, passed inspection. Total: $1,580.
